How do you create light streaks in Photoshop?
A new layer appears above the Background layer. As I mentioned at the beginning, we're going to create our light streaks by drawing paths and then stroking the paths with a brush. To draw paths, we need the Pen Tool, so select it from the Tools palette. You can also press the letter P to select it with the keyboard shortcut: Select the Pen Tool.
